Hamilton Beach' monstrous mini oven makes other toaster ovens cower in fear. The specs don't lie: You really can cook two frozen pizzas or eight baked potatoes at once, courtesy of two levels of 144-square-inch cooking grids. We even cooked a whole chicken on the spinning rotisserie: It isn't perfect, but it did the job, crisping up the bird nicely. There are other aspects to the Hamilton's aren't perfect either: The analog controls are hard to read and not very accurate, and you'll pay for the size in the form of slow heating (it took 22 minutes to hit 350 degrees and topped out at 360, though it claims 450 degrees as the top temp). —Christopher Null
__
WIRED__ Easily the best unit if you don't have a standard oven. Easy cleanup thanks to front-loading crumb tray. Handles big cooking jobs without complaint. Quite the bargain.

TIRED Not the best at toasting plain bread, which requires extensive experimentation to keep from simply drying instead of browning toast. Enormous footprint. Baking pans have embossed pattern, making them difficult to use for cookies and the like.

How We Tested: We evaluated 14 countertop convection ovens, assessing their ability to make toast, roast a chicken, bake yellow cake from a mix, broil steaks, and heat pizza on a pizza setting, if featured. We also evaluated each product's ease of use, including a review of owner's manuals, operating control panels, programming the ovens, opening the door, ease of cleaning, and the surface temperature reached during broiling. For an oven with steam capability, we evaluated the ability to steam broccoli, salmon, chicken, and potatoes. For an oven with pressure capability, we also tested the ability to roast a turkey, chicken, and beef under pressure.

Small enough to fit on your kitchen counter, but large enough to help you prepare for any snack, meal or party, the Hamilton Beach Countertop Oven with Convection & Rotisserie boasts full-size oven performance in a compact, energy-efficient form. Designed with both kitchen style and practicality in mind, this oven is packed with versatile cooking options that range from baking cakes to broiling salmon to roasting an entire 5 lb. chicken. The wide interior and two adjustable cooking racks provide double the space for cooking multiple foods at once. Extra-Large Capacity There’s plenty of room in this countertop oven for any meal. It fits two 12” pizzas, two 9" x 13" casseroles or two cake pans. Or fit an entire 5 lb. chicken using the revolving rotisserie. Convection & Rotisserie Take your roasting and baking results to the next level with two additional oven settings. The convection setting bakes faster and more evenly than traditional ovens. And the rotisserie revolves meat while cooking, which locks in flavor and juices and turns the outside brown and crispy. Accessories Included Included with your oven is everything you need to get baking, broiling and roasting right away. Including a removable drip tray, rotisserie skewer & lifter, 2 oven racks, 2 baking pans and a broiler rack. What's the difference between rotisserie and convection?

Rotisserie ovens rotate the birds on a spit while cooking in convection heat. Rotisserie ovens are traditionally seen in grocery stores to cook chicken, but these ovens can also cook lamb, turkey, vegetables, and more with accessories. Combi ovens feature a combination of convection heat and steam.
